Bancroft Duck Pond
Bancroft Duck Pond, located in Missoula, MT, is a tranquil oasis nestled within the bustling city—a serene escape for nature enthusiasts and families alike. The park boasts a picturesque setting, with lush greenery, meandering pathways, and a shimmering pond that serves as a haven for a variety of waterfowl.
Visitors can meander along the winding trails, enjoying the peaceful ambiance and the melodic sounds of chirping birds. The park's well-maintained grounds offer ample opportunities for picnicking, birdwatching, or simply unwinding amidst the beauty of the outdoors. Bancroft Duck Pond is not just a park—it's a rejuvenating retreat where one can connect with nature and find solace in its peaceful surroundings.
Generated using this place's available information
